Key Ingredients
Olive Oil
Olive oil (1/4 cup): This rich and fragrant oil serves as the base for the marinade, adding a smooth texture and a hint of fruitiness to the dish. It also helps to balance the acidity of the balsamic vinegar.
Balsamic Vinegar
Balsamic vinegar (1/2 cup): The star ingredient, this vinegar provides a unique sweet-tangy flavor that elevates the mushrooms. Its complex notes bring depth to the marinade, making it a perfect complement to the earthy taste of the mushrooms.
Garlic
Garlic (2 cloves, minced): Freshly minced garlic adds a pungent aroma and a savory kick to the marinade. Its bold flavor infuses the mushrooms, enhancing their natural taste and providing an irresistible depth.
Fresh Rosemary
Fresh rosemary (1 tablespoon, chopped): This aromatic herb contributes a pine-like fragrance and a subtle earthiness to the dish. Its distinct flavor pairs beautifully with the mushrooms, adding an herbal note that brightens the overall profile.
Honey
Honey (1 tablespoon): A touch of sweetness from honey balances the acidity of the balsamic vinegar, making the marinade more harmonious. It also helps to create a glossy finish on the mushrooms after marinating.
Mushrooms
Mushrooms (1 pound): The main ingredient, mushrooms absorb the flavors of the marinade beautifully. Their meaty texture and umami-rich taste make them the perfect vehicle for the vibrant marinade, turning them into a delicious dish.

Variations
Balsamic marinated mushrooms are incredibly versatile, allowing you to customize them to suit your taste preferences or to match the occasion. Here are a few delicious variations to try out that can elevate this already delightful dish.
Add Extra Vegetables
Consider adding other vegetables to your marinade for added flavor and texture. Bell peppers, zucchini, or even cherry tomatoes can complement the mushrooms beautifully. Simply chop the extra veggies and toss them in with the mushrooms to soak up that fantastic balsamic flavor.
Spice It Up
If you enjoy a little heat, try adding red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ce to the marinade. This will introduce a pleasant kick that contrasts nicely with the sweetness of the balsamic vinegar and honey, making your dish more exciting and dynamic.
Cheese It Up
For a richer flavor profile, add crumbled feta or shaved Parmesan cheese just before serving. The creaminess of the cheese combined with the tangy marinade creates a delightful balance, making these mushrooms not just an appetizer but a gourmet experience.
Herb Variations
While fresh rosemary is a fantastic choice, feel free to experiment with other herbs like thyme, oregano, or basil. Each herb brings its own unique flavor and aroma, allowing you to tailor the dish to your liking. Just make sure to adjust the quantity according to the strength of the herb you choose.
Sweet and Savory
For a more complex flavor, add some chopped nuts, like walnuts or pecans, along with the honey. The crunchiness of the nuts paired with the marinated mushrooms creates an enjoyable contrast that adds texture and richness to the dish.

Cooking Tips and Notes
Balsamic marinated mushrooms are not only delicious but also incredibly easy to prepare, making them a perfect choice for time-pressed young professionals. Here are some tips and notes to ensure your dish turns out perfectly every time.
Marination Time
For the best flavor, it’s crucial to allow the mushrooms to marinate for at least 30 minutes, but if you have the time, letting them sit overnight in the refrigerator will significantly enhance their taste. This extended marination helps the mushrooms absorb the rich flavors of the balsamic vinegar and other ingredients, resulting in a more flavorful dish.
Serving Suggestions
These balsamic marinated mushrooms can be served cold or at room temperature, making them an excellent make-ahead option for parties or gatherings. Consider pairing them with a fresh salad, or serve them as part of a charcuterie board alongside cheeses and cured meats to impress your guests.
Adjusting Sweetness
Don’t hesitate to tweak the sweetness of the marinade to suit your palate. If you prefer a sweeter taste, simply add a bit more honey. On the other hand, if you’re looking for a tangier profile, reduce the amount of honey or increase the balsamic vinegar slightly. This customization allows you to create a dish that perfectly matches your flavor preferences.
Fresh Ingredients Matter
Using fresh ingredients, particularly fresh rosemary and high-quality balsamic vinegar, can make all the difference in the final outcome. The freshness of the herbs enhances the overall flavor and aroma, making the dish more vibrant and appealing.

FAQ
What are balsamic marinated mushrooms?
Balsamic marinated mushrooms are a flavorful dish made by soaking fresh mushrooms in a marinade of balsamic vinegar, olive oil, garlic, and herbs. They are versatile and can be served as appetizers, in salads, or as a side dish.
How long should I marinate the mushrooms?
For optimal flavor, it’s recommended to marinate the mushrooms for at least 30 minutes, but marinating them overnight will enhance their taste even further, allowing the flavors to fully penetrate the mushrooms.
Can I use different types of mushrooms?
Absolutely! While this recipe calls for standard mushrooms, you can experiment with other varieties like cremini, portobello, or shiitake mushrooms. Each type will bring its own unique flavor and texture to the dish.
How should I store leftover marinated mushrooms?
Store any leftover balsamic marinated mushrooms in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They can last for about 3-5 days, making them a great option for meal prep or as a quick snack.
Are balsamic marinated mushrooms healthy?
Yes! Balsamic marinated mushrooms are low in calories and fat while providing a good source of vitamins and minerals. They are a great addition to a balanced diet, especially for vegetarian and health-conscious eaters.

Balsamic Marinated Mushrooms
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Delicious balsamic marinated mushrooms, perfect for salads, appetizers, or as a side dish.
Ingredients
- 1 pound mushrooms
- 1/2 cup balsamic vinegar
- 1/4 cup olive o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on fresh rosemary, chopped
- 1 tablespoon honey
- Salt to taste
- Black pepper to taste
Instructions
- In a bowl, whisk together balsamic vinegar, olive oil, garlic, rosemary, honey, salt, and pepper.
- Add the mushrooms to the marinade and toss to coat.
-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
- Serve cold or at room temperature.
Notes
- For best flavor, marinate the mushrooms overnight.
- Adjust the sweetness by varying the amount of honey.
